SDCL § 23A-27-20: (Rule 32(f)) Hearing required to revoke probation or suspension of sentence--Bail pending hearing.

A court shall not revoke a probation or a suspension of imposition of sentence, except after a hearing at which the defendant shall be present and apprised of the grounds on which such action is proposed. A defendant may be admitted to bail pending such hearing.

Source: SL 1978, ch 178, § 350.
